EFSUMB Guidelines on Interventional Ultrasound (INVUS), Part V.

P Fusaroli1, C Jenssen2, M Hocke3

  • 1Gastroenterology Unit, Department of Medical and Surgical Sciences University of Bologna/Hospital of Imola, Italy.

Ultraschall in Der Medizin (Stuttgart, Germany : 1980)
|December 4, 2015
PubMed
Summary
This summary is machine-generated.

This review summarizes evidence for endoscopic ultrasound-guided treatments, including celiac plexus block and drainage procedures. It provides clinical practice recommendations for interventional ultrasound (INVUS).

Area of Science:

  • Gastroenterology
  • Interventional Radiology
  • Medical Guidelines

Background:

  • The European Federation of Societies for Ultrasound in Medicine and Biology (EFSUMB) provides guidelines for medical professionals.
  • Interventional Ultrasound (INVUS) is an evolving field with various therapeutic applications.
  • Evidence-based guidelines are crucial for standardizing and advancing medical procedures.

Purpose of the Study:

  • To assess and summarize the current evidence for all categories of endoscopic ultrasound-guided treatments.
  • To provide major recommendations for clinical practice based on extensive evidence analysis.
  • To update the EFSUMB Guidelines on Interventional Ultrasound (INVUS).

Main Methods:

  • Systematic review and analysis of existing evidence on endoscopic ultrasound-guided treatments.
  • Categorization of treatments including celiac plexus neurolysis/block, vascular interventions, and drainage procedures.
  • Summarization of findings into actionable recommendations for clinical practice.

Main Results:

  • Comprehensive analysis of evidence for celiac plexus neurolysis and block.
  • Evaluation of evidence for vascular interventions guided by endoscopic ultrasound.
  • Summary of evidence for drainage of fluid collections, and biliary and pancreatic ducts.
  • Assessment of experimental tumor ablation techniques using endoscopic ultrasound.

Conclusions:

  • The fifth section of the EFSUMB INVUS Guidelines provides a thorough evidence assessment.
  • Recommendations are established for celiac plexus neurolysis/block, vascular interventions, and drainage procedures.
  • The guidelines offer essential information for clinicians performing interventional ultrasound procedures.
